Arsenal are interested in Barcelona forward Ferran Torres, according to reputable journalist Dean Jones.

The Gunners, have been on the market for a winger since the summer, with Shakhtar Donetsk's Mykhailo Mudryk thought to be their priority target.

However, the injury suffered by Gabriel Jesus while representing Brazil at the World Cup may force the Gunners into signing an attacker that can play centrally.

Advert

Indeed, Arsenal boss Mikel Arteta is said to be interested in former Manchester City forward Torres, who currently plies his trade for Catalan giants Barcelona.

Arsenal in for Torres?

Jones has claimed that Arsenal “clearly believe” Torres will be available for transfer in January, with the club having previously enquired about the 22-year-old’s availability in the summer.

Speaking to GiveMeSport Jones claimed: “They really like Ferran Torres, and they clearly believe he might become available because they inquired about him in the summer as well.

“So, if they’re sniffing around him again now, they sense that something’s up.”

Torres, registered 16 goals and four assists in his 43 appearances of City, and has clocked up a similar tally at Barcelona.

Advert

In his 44 outings for Xavi Hernandez’s side, the forward has netted 12 times and provided seven assists.

While Torres is not the most clinical of forwards, his intelligence and technical ability led him to be described as “world-class” by his Barcelona boss.

In a February press conference, Xavi said, via SportsMole: "Perhaps Ferran has surprised me the most. He's a player on another level, he's spectacular: how he understands the space, links play, doesn't lose the ball, his defensive work... he's world-class. He's a great signing, one I wanted, and a wonderful footballer,"
